This is a lite weight mount that is easy to carry out into the yard on clear nights, and I've been happy with it. Even so, there are some things one should consider before buying.1) There is no tech support ... or rather Sky Watcher's tech support department seemingly consists of just one person, Alex, and he does not want to talk to you ... at all ... ever. Stop bothering him. I tried calling multiple times, hoping to get someone else, but got Alex every time. I tried sending emails, but again, Alex every time, and he had exactly zero interest helping me resolve the issue that I had.2) The GOTO functionality is really GO(near)TO. The reason for this is that star alignment is nearly impossible unless you live out on the plains somewhere with zero obstructions on your horizon. What I found was that every time I tried to do a star alignment, I could pick any 1st star I wanted, but then was only given an option of 3 or 4 stars for the 2nd star ... every one of them right on the horizon. I have a fine view of the sky where I am, but not of the horizon. From the horizon up to 10°(ish) above the horizon, I can't see. The result of this is that I can only ever do a 1-star alignment, which means that I only have GO(near)TO functionality.3) The leveling bubble is VERY poorly placed. You can only see it from the side, and not straight down. This makes leveling the mount a little bothersome.On the bright side, this mount works well with my battery pack jump starter that I got from the auto-parts store to jump start my mower. I didn't even have to buy a cable as the cable that came with the jump starter was the right size for the plug on the mount.Had I to do it over again, I would still buy this mount. The price is great for a GO(near)TO mount. It's easy to use, well built, lite weight, and it tracks just fine. It supports the weight of my 80mm refractor and camera without any issue.
